浏览代码

企业浏览信息及文章修改

jack 8 年之前
父节点
当前提交
3bf9029a3a
共有 3 个文件被更改,包括 26 次插入6 次删除
  1. 19 3
      cmp-portal/js/companybrowinfor.js
  2. 1 1
      companybrowinfor.html
  3. 6 2
      js/articalInfo.js

+ 19 - 3
cmp-portal/js/companybrowinfor.js

1
$(document).ready(function() {
1
$(document).ready(function() {
2
	var id = GetQueryString("orgId");
2
	var id = GetQueryString("orgId");
3
	var oComDescp,oComIndustry,oComSubject,oComQualification,oComUser;
4
	loginStatus();//判断个人是否登录
3
	/*企业信息*/
5
	/*企业信息*/
4
	function companyInformation() {
6
	function companyInformation() {
5
		$.ajax({
7
		$.ajax({
44
					if($data.descp) {
46
					if($data.descp) {
45
						$(".editbox").text($data.descp);
47
						$(".editbox").text($data.descp);
46
					} else {
48
					} else {
49
						oComDescp=0;
47
						$("span:contains('企业简介')").parents(".introduction").hide();
50
						$("span:contains('企业简介')").parents(".introduction").hide();
48
						$("a:contains('企业简介')").hide();
51
						$("a:contains('企业简介')").hide();
49
					}
52
					}
96
					if($data.industry) {
99
					if($data.industry) {
97
						indu($data.industry, '#industryShow')
100
						indu($data.industry, '#industryShow')
98
					} else {
101
					} else {
102
						oComIndustry=0;
99
						$("span:contains('所属行业')").parents(".introduction").hide();
103
						$("span:contains('所属行业')").parents(".introduction").hide();
100
						$("a:contains('所属行业')").hide();
104
						$("a:contains('所属行业')").hide();
101
					}
105
					}
102
					if($data.subject) {
106
					if($data.subject) {
103
						indu($data.subject, '#subjectShow')
107
						indu($data.subject, '#subjectShow')
104
					} else {
108
					} else {
109
						oComSubject=0;
105
						$("span:contains('专注领域')").parents(".introduction").hide();
110
						$("span:contains('专注领域')").parents(".introduction").hide();
106
						$("a:contains('专注领域')").hide();
111
						$("a:contains('专注领域')").hide();
107
					}
112
					}
108
					if($data.qualification) {
113
					if($data.qualification) {
109
						indu($data.qualification, '#qiye ')
114
						indu($data.qualification, '#qiye ')
110
					} else {
115
					} else {
111
						$("span:contains('企业用户')").parents(".introduction").hide();
112
						$("a:contains('企业用户')").hide();
116
						oComQualification=0;
117
						$("span:contains('企业资质')").parents(".introduction").hide();
118
						$("a:contains('企业资质')").hide();
113
					}
119
					}
114
				}
120
				}
115
			},
121
			},
151
			success: function(data, textState) {
157
			success: function(data, textState) {
152
				if(data.success) {
158
				if(data.success) {
153
					var $info = data.data;
159
					var $info = data.data;
160
					if($info.length==0){
161
						$("span:contains('企业用户')").parents(".introduction").hide();
162
						$("a:contains('企业用户')").hide();
163
						oComUser=0;
164
						if(oComDescp==0&&oComIndustry==0&&oComSubject==0&&oComQualification==0&&oComUser==0){
165
							$("div:contains('企业信息')").parents(".content-left").hide();
166
						}
167
					}
154
					userHtml($info);
168
					userHtml($info);
155
				}
169
				}
156
			},
170
			},
201
		timeout: 10000, //超时设置
215
		timeout: 10000, //超时设置
202
		success: function(data) {
216
		success: function(data) {
203
			if(data.success) {
217
			if(data.success) {
218
				if(data.data.length==0){
219
					$("span:contains('科研文章')").parents(".introduction").hide();
220
				}
204
					for(var i = 0; i < data.data.length; i++) {
221
					for(var i = 0; i < data.data.length; i++) {
205
						var add = '<li><a href="articalInfo.html?oFlag=1&articleId=' + data.data[i].articleId + '&professorId=' + data.data[i].orgId + '" style="display:block;">'
222
						var add = '<li><a href="articalInfo.html?oFlag=1&articleId=' + data.data[i].articleId + '&professorId=' + data.data[i].orgId + '" style="display:block;">'
206
						add += '<div class="art_topicBox"><div class="art_img" style=""></div>'
223
						add += '<div class="art_topicBox"><div class="art_img" style=""></div>'
225
			return;
242
			return;
226
		}
243
		}
227
	})
244
	})
228
	
229
})
245
})

+ 1 - 1
companybrowinfor.html

189
		$(".subsidebar").eq($(".subsidebar").index(this)).addClass("subcolor");
189
		$(".subsidebar").eq($(".subsidebar").index(this)).addClass("subcolor");
190
	});
190
	});
191
	$(".subsidebar").click(function() {
191
	$(".subsidebar").click(function() {
192
		var index = $(".subsidebar").index(this);
192
		var index = $(".subsidebar").index(this)+1;
193
        //console.log(index)
193
        //console.log(index)
194
		var offset = $(".introduction").eq(index).offset();
194
		var offset = $(".introduction").eq(index).offset();
195
		$("body,html").animate({
195
		$("body,html").animate({

+ 6 - 2
js/articalInfo.js

2
	var articleId = GetQueryString("articleId");
2
	var articleId = GetQueryString("articleId");
3
	var professorId = GetQueryString("professorId");
3
	var professorId = GetQueryString("professorId");
4
	var oFlag = GetQueryString("oFlag");
4
	var oFlag = GetQueryString("oFlag");
5
	console.log(oFlag)
5
	loginStatus();//判断个人是否登录
6
	var userid = $.cookie("userid");
6
	var userid = $.cookie("userid");
7
	if(userid == "null") {
7
	if(userid == "null"||userid==undefined) {
8
		$(".goMsgbox").hide();
8
		$(".goMsgbox").hide();
9
	} else {
9
	} else {
10
		$("#login").hide();
10
		$("#login").hide();
174
			success: function(data) {
174
			success: function(data) {
175
				var $info = data.data || {};
175
				var $info = data.data || {};
176
				if(data.success && data.data) {
176
				if(data.success && data.data) {
177
					//console.log(JSON.stringify(data));
177
					$(".commentList").html("");
178
					$(".commentList").html("");
178
					$(".message").text($info.length);
179
					$(".message").text($info.length);
179
					for(var i = 0; i < $info.length; i++) {
180
					for(var i = 0; i < $info.length; i++) {
189
						string += '<div class="media-body floatL">'
190
						string += '<div class="media-body floatL">'
190
						string += '<div><span class="listtit">'+$info[i].professor.name+'</span><span class="thistime">'+time+'</span></div>'
191
						string += '<div><span class="listtit">'+$info[i].professor.name+'</span><span class="thistime">'+time+'</span></div>'
191
						string += '<p class="listtit3">'+$info[i].content+'</p>'
192
						string += '<p class="listtit3">'+$info[i].content+'</p>'
193
						if(userid==$info[i].professor.id){
194
							string += '<p class="listtit3" style="text-align:right;"><span style="cursor:pointer;">删除</span></p>'
195
						}
192
						string += '</div></a></li>'
196
						string += '</div></a></li>'
193
						$(".commentList").append(string);
197
						$(".commentList").append(string);
194
					}
198
					}